#include "blis.h"
//
// Define BLAS-to-BLIS interfaces.
//
#undef GENTFUNC
#define GENTFUNC( ftype_x, chx, blasname, blisname ) \
\
f77_int PASTEF772(i,chx,blasname) \
( \
const f77_int* n, \
const ftype_x* x, const f77_int* incx \
) \
{ \
dim_t n0; \
ftype_x* x0; \
inc_t incx0; \
gint_t bli_index; \
f77_int f77_index; \
\
/* If the vector is empty, return an index of zero. This early check
is needed to emulate netlib BLAS. Without it, bli_?amaxv() will
return 0, which ends up getting incremented to 1 (below) before
being returned, which is not what we want. */ \
if ( *n < 1 || *incx <= 0 ) return 0; \
\
/* Initialize BLIS. */ \
bli_init_auto(); \
\
/* Convert/typecast negative values of n to zero. */ \
bli_convert_blas_dim1( *n, n0 ); \
\
/* If the input increments are negative, adjust the pointers so we can
use positive increments instead. */ \
bli_convert_blas_incv( n0, (ftype_x*)x, *incx, x0, incx0 ); \
\
/* Call BLIS interface. */ \
PASTEMAC2(chx,blisname,BLIS_TAPI_EX_SUF) \
( \
n0, \
x0, incx0, \
&bli_index, \
NULL, \
NULL \
); \
\
/* Convert zero-based BLIS (C) index to one-based BLAS (Fortran)
index. Also, if the BLAS integer size differs from the BLIS
integer size, that typecast occurs here. */ \
f77_index = bli_index + 1; \
\
/* Finalize BLIS. */ \
bli_finalize_auto(); \
\
return f77_index; \
}
#ifdef BLIS_ENABLE_BLAS
INSERT_GENTFUNC_BLAS( amax, amaxv )
#endif
